The Solar Battery Market Shift

solar battery costs have become the make-or-break factor for renewable energy adoption. Recent data from BloombergNEF shows lithium-ion prices dropped 12% year-over-year, yet installation expenses remain stubbornly high in developing markets. Why does this paradox exist?

Well, here's the kicker: while raw material costs decreased, logistics nightmares and complex regulations added 18-23% to final project quotes in East Africa last quarter. Take Tanzania's new import duties - they've sort of backfired, creating a 40-day customs bottleneck that increased warehouse fees by $8/m²/month.

The Hidden Fees Trap

Highjoule Technologies recently audited 47 solar projects in Zambia. Wait, no - actually, it was 52 projects. The findings? Nearly 70% of price fluctuations came from "invisible" costs:

  • Permit processing delays (avg. 29 days)
  • Grid interconnection red tape
  • Battery performance mismatches
